Document Description
Allow expansion and modification of an existing marina including an increase from 374 to 474 moorage slips on 722.30 acres of land in the RC-40 (Resource Conservation, 40-acre minimum parcel size) Zone District. The project site is located on the south side of SR 168 (Tollhouse Road), approximately one mile north of its intersection with Dalton Avenue within the unincorporated community of Shaver Lake (45795 Tollhouse Road) (SUP. DIST.:5)(APN: 120-070-10U, 120-080-01U).
